im getting a sb memory card for my nextel i870 and one for my i880, and i wanted to no should i go with the 512mb or the 1gb,what is the diffrence between mb and gb,witch one is more space, and is it so many mb equal a gb or somthing.

1,024 Byte = 1 Kilobyte (KB)
1,024 Kilobyte (KB) = 1 Megabyte (MB)
1,073,741,824 Bytes = 1 Gigabyte (GB)
1 Gigabyte (GB) = 1,024 Megabyte (MB)

(For approximation, you can say 1GB = 1000MB)

So your 512MB card is half the capacity of the 1GB card.
